专利名称:电话自动拨号机的制作方法
技术领域:
本实用新型属于电话机的专用设备,它代替人工重复拨号的一种电话自动拨号机。
目前由于我国通信事业的落后,电话线路极其紧张,用电话呼叫火车站(定票或问询)以及呼叫各大企业、公司的业务联系,生产调度等都一时难于叫通,电话接通率低,公务人员需反复的呼叫,给日常工作带来很多困难。
为了解决对某些电话重复呼叫所带来的困难,研制出一种附加在普通电话用户上的完全代替手工重复拨号的电话自动拨号机。
电话自动拨号机接在电话机的保安接线盒上,和话机并联,电话拨号机上有键盘、指示灯和数字显示;有全自动拨号音、忙音、回铃音识别;对忙音采取尽快挂机、重拨;对第一次听到的回铃音占线,报警提示,用户则迅速摘下听筒通话。使用者在一次起动之后,可在附近从事其它工作。电话自动拨号机采用INTEL8039单片计算机,与固化后的程序存储器2732及地址锁储器,显示驱动器构成一个最小的计算机系统,通过键盘获取命令,数码显示电路显示,当输入号码后,起动“开始”命令,计算机对摘机、挂机控制电路进行控制,发码电路发出号码;由信号耦合电路拾取线路上的返回信号,(忙音、拨号音、回铃音)经过滤波放大,积分比较出相应的TTL电平信号,由计算机进行识别,发出相应的指令动作重拨或报警提示。
以下结合附图加以说明
图1电话自动拨号机电路原理图图2电话自动拨号机流程图图3(a)滤波器电路图(b)滤波器波形图图4发码电路图5(a)放大器电路(b)比较电路(c)摘挂机电路图1电话自动拨号机电路原理框图电话自动拨号机是由小计算机系统、键盘13、发码电路6、摘挂机电路7、信号隔离耦合电路8、滤波器9、放大器10、积分比较11和报警电路12,其中的小计算机系统由单片机1、地址锁存器2、程序存储器3、显示驱动器4、和数码显示器5组成。当电源开关开启后,单片机8039中CPU由地址单元000H开始,将各状态置为初始化状态,即挂机(P26=1),不发码(P27=0),不报警(P25=1),数码显示暗(锁存器输出清“0”,然后锁存)状态,然后由P1□的P10~P13依次置“0”,由P14~P16依次读入,若有一个为“0”。则表示相应的按健按下,将相应的代码放入单片机内RAM区020H开始的单元中。将所需的电话号码及重拨间隔时间全部键入后,按“开始”键,则不再读键盘,转入拨号程序单元中,首先P26=“0”,摘机,延时1秒将020H单元中代码取出,P21=“0”信号,发码电路送出一个40ms、60V的信号,P27=“1”,发码电路送出一个小于7V,60ms的信号,相当发出一个脉冲,重复的次数为代码值,发出相应的按键的号,见下表
当重复次数为代码值时,取出下一个021H单元中的代码,进行发码,然后取出下一个单元,重复,每次间隔时间为0.5秒,直到取出代码为“开始”键代码89H时,则停止发码,这时仍处于摘机状态。
若拨通,由电话线上送来了一个400~525Hz,1秒续4秒停的正弦信号,通藕篷詈掀鞯酱砦狟W=125Hz的有源通滤波器,将400~525Hz以外的干扰,杂音滤除干净,然后由LM324组成的运算放大器放大,采用±15V电源供电,确保信号动态范围,放大倍数为15倍,放大后的正弦信号通过LM324组成第一级比较电路,由反相端6脚设置为1V的门限,由7脚输出为脉冲占空比比较一致幅度均为15V的双极性400~525Hz方波,解决话线上返回信号幅值不一致所造成的问题,然后由开关二极管VD2(2AK1)整流出单极性400~525Hz脉冲幅值一致的方波,由C5、R21组成的积分滤波器将400~525Hz信号滤波为较平滑的直流信号,即1秒有信号为高电平,4秒无信号为低电平,再由LM339比较器比较输出边缘徒直的电平与TTL兼容的方波,即1秒为“1”电平,4秒为“0”电平的TTL信号。送入单片机To端进行计时判别,当“1”电平脉冲大于0.75秒,小于1.5秒时,则认为回铃音,保持摘机状态,置P25为0.5秒“0”,0.5秒为“1”,由74L04反相器驱动压电蜂鸣器,间歇报警,时间为20秒,然后挂机回到初始化状态。
若信号为忙音,原理同上,To端计时判别,“1”电平脉冲大于0.2秒,小于0.75秒时为忙音,则挂机,保持1秒后再摘机等待0.5秒,使电话交换机恢复原状,稳定后,再重复以上的拨号工作。在定时到后仍没拨通,则挂机,且P25置“0”1.5秒,“1”1.5秒,使蜂鸣器重复1分钟音响,提醒用户注意。
对摘机或拨外线字头后,对蜂音判别,信号原理同上,To端计时检测为“1”,时间大于0.75秒,并且信号不间断,则再拨下面号码,如小于0.75秒,则挂机重拨。对于用户置入的重拨时间间隔,在“开始”键按下后,摘机之前置于计数延时单元中。间隔时间由2秒~99秒,由用户置入,最小单位为1秒,每次不通挂机后延时置入的时间同时由数码管亮1秒灭1秒,闪烁显示“H”字符,再重复。如果拨完号之后,15秒内无任何信号(如串线情况等)则挂机重拨。
对于每种状态下,数码显示原理是是由P1□输出显示字符的代码,然后P24置“0”,锁存器打开,则P1□数据送致数码显示,然后P24=“1”,将显示内容锁存于D4锁存器中保存,各种显示字符在301H开始的地址单元中,见表2
图2电话自动拨号机流程图首先初始化,即挂机,不发码、不报警、然后将键盘设置为读写状态,读取号码,每读取一位号码,就放入RAM区中,020H地址单元开始,即第一个码放在01FH+n单元(n=1)即020H,然后判别是否命令键“开始”代码89H,不是则继续读键盘,当判别为“开始”代码89H时,则呈现拨号状态“-”,继电器J闭合(摘机),判别是否为拨号音,不是延时1秒,仍不是,则挂机,重新摘机,当是拨号音时,取出RAM区中的号码,逐位按代码所代表的脉冲数通断光电耦合器,发出相应的号码,全部发完之后,检测To口电平即检测话线返回的信号,当电平为“1”,开始计时,计到恢复为“0”时,进行判别,判别出是忙音还是回铃音,如果是回铃音,即表示拨通,数码管闪烁显示“日.”,并且蜂鸣器鸣响20秒,然后挂机,回到读键盘状态。如果判别是忙音,则挂机判别定时到否,到,则不用再拨,挂机;不到,延时定时重拨时间,再继续重拨状态。
图3(a)滤波器电路图(b)滤波器波形图根据切比雪夫有源带通滤波器原理,由一个低通滤波器、高通滤波器和运算放大器LM324组成的带通滤波器,从滤波器波形图可以看出,其带宽为BW=125Hz,中心频率fo=462.5Hz,带外衰减≥26dB,带内波动≤1dB,将400~525Hz以外的干扰杂音滤除。从话线上返回的回铃音、忙音等信号频率都较低,若采用电感电容组成LC滤波器的话,他的体积大,不易调整,电气性能达不到要求。
本滤波器是由两级带通滤波器组成,其一级R30和C9组成一个低通滤波器,C8、R31组成高通滤波器,构成一个带通滤波器,他和LM324、正反馈电阻R32、负反馈电阻R34、电阻R33组成的运算放大器相连。第二级R25、C7组成低通滤波器,C6、R26组成高通滤波器,LM324和R27、R28、R29组稍怂惴糯笃髯槌伞S捎诓捎昧浇诖瞬ㄆ鳎纳屏寺瞬ㄆ鞯男阅堋 图4发码电路。
发码电路采用光电耦合器N1、与非门74LS04、电阻R14和R15、指示灯VD4组成。与非门D5的输出和发码指示灯VD4、光电耦合器N1中的二极管一端相接,R14、R15的另一端接在一块接+5V电压。光电耦合器中三极管集电极上串接一电阻R16,电阻的另一端和发射极并在电话线上。光电耦合器中二极管两端加上电压时,二极管发光,传递到光敏三极管上,三极管接收,使集电极和发射极导通,发光二极管没加电压时,发光三极管没有光的激励而截止。输入是电信号,在光电耦合器N1内部是光信号传递,输出为电信号,整个过程在管内进行,互不干扰。
发码电路由单片机8039的P27送“0”信号,经D5的3入4出,反相为“1”信号,光电耦合器N1中的发光二极管不亮,输出三极管截止,发射极和集电极并在话路上,呈现开路状态,电压为60伏,保持40ms。当8039的P21送来一个“1”信号时,经D5的3入4出一个“0”信号,光电耦合器N1中发光二极管发光,输出三极管导通,发射极和集电极并在话路上的阻抗是导通三极管的内阻和电阻R16之和,小于550Ω,阻值很低,相当于将电话线给“短路”,电压小于7伏,保持60ms,整个过程相当发出一个脉冲。
图5(a)放大器电路由LM324和电阻R22、R23、R24组成信号放大器。
(b)比较电路运算放大器由LM324和RP2组成第一级比较电路,由反相端6脚设置为1V的门限,7脚输出为脉冲占空比比较一致,幅度为±13V的双极性400~525Hz方波,经VD2(2AK1)整流出单极性400~525脉冲幅值一致的方波,然后由C5、R21组成的积分滤波器将400~525Hz信号滤波为较平滑的直流信号,再由LM339比较器比较输出边缘徒直的电平于TTL兼容的方波。
(c)摘挂机电路当计算机8039的P26=0,经反相器的D5的5入6出VD5摘机指示灯亮,同时经二次反相后,为“1”,三极管BG1导通,J1继电器动作,电话线上的接点吸合。
图六为电话自动拨号机的外观图电话自动拨号机,采用ABS工程塑料,体积为16×13×8cm3,如图六所示正面板14、背面板15、机壳16、支角17音响报警孔18、八段数码显示孔19、状态显示发光二极管20、数字及命令键盘21、关音响及系统复位按键22、电源开关23。
操作步骤1.开启电源开关,电源指示灯亮。
2.通过键盘输入所叫用户电话号码及命令。
a.若主叫用户为直拨电话,则直接按入对方的电话号码。
例2017251数码管显示相应的拨号b.若主叫用户为内线电话,被叫用户为外线电话,先按“0”,再拨被叫用户的电话号码。
例0.20172513.键入每次间隔时间为2秒~99秒若我们选用的间隔时间为35秒,在按完电话号码以后,按一个·35若选用的间隔时间为小于10秒,按一个·OX。
若选用的间隔时间为小于2秒,不用按间隔时间。
若选用的间隔时间为大于99秒,只取数字的前2位。
在按间隔时间的同时,数码管显示相应的健号。
4.按“开始”键,则机器自动运行,使用者可以在附近从事其它的工作。当机器“嘟、嘟……”以0.5秒响,0.5秒停的鸣叫时,数码管以同样节拍闪烁显示“日.”,表示对方电话已拨通,使用者应尽快拿起电话听筒与对方通话。按下机器关音键或关掉电源开关。
权利要求1.一种代替人工重复拨号的电话自动拨号机,其特征在于它由小计算机系统和键盘控制的发码电路、摘挂机电路、拾取电话线上信号的隔离耦合电路、滤波器、放大器、积分比较组成,该机并联在话机上,其中小计算机系统由地址锁存器、程序存储器、显示驱动器、数码显示管和报警器组成。
2.根据权利要求1所述的电话自动拨号机,其特征在于发码电路是由和光电耦合器N1相连的反相器D5、指示灯VD4、电阻R14、R15、R16组成。
3.根据权利要求1所述的电话自动拨号机,其特征在于滤波器是一个由低通滤波器、高通滤波器和运算放大器组成的有源带通滤波器,采用两级,其第一级由R30、C9组成低通滤波器;C8、R31组成高通滤波器,LM324和正反馈电阻R32、负反馈电阻R34、电阻R33组成的运算放大器组成,第二级由R25、C7组成低通滤波器、C6、R26组成高通滤波器、LM324和正反馈电阻R27、负反馈电阻R29、电阻R28组成的运算放大器组成。
4.根据权利要求1所述的电话自动拨号机,其特征在于所述的小计算机系统在控制每次重拨间隔时间在2秒~99秒是由单片计算机向固化后的程序存储器、地址销存器、显示驱动器、数码管组成。
5.根据权利要求1所述的电话自动拨号机,其特征在于电话自动拨号机和电话机并联,接在保安接线盒上。
专利摘要电话自动拨号机采用8039单片机与固化后的程序存储器2732及地址锁存器构成计算机系统,通过键盘获取号码及命令,数码显示电路同时显示,通过摘机挂机电路,发码电路实现摘挂机动作及拨号过程,由信号耦合电路拾取电话线上返回的信号,带通滤波器滤出拨号音、忙音、回铃音等信号,通过放大、积分比较出相应的TTL电平信号,由计算机系统识别,作出相应的动作重拨或报警。
文档编号H04M1/23GK2051806SQ89207700
公开日1990年1月24日 申请日期1989年6月1日 优先权日1989年6月1日
发明者张宏博, 张其善 申请人:张宏博